为什么vue编辑不了视频

fiy 其他 19

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ue本身是一个用于构建用户界面的开源JavaScript框架,它并不直接涉及视频编辑功能。如果你想开发一个具有视频编辑功能的应用,你可能需要结合使用Vue和其他技术来实现。

    在vue中,你可以使用HTML5的Video标签来嵌入和显示视频。下面是一个简单的示例:

    <template>
      <div>
        <video src="path_to_video_file"></video>
      </div>
    </template>
    
    <script>
    export default {
      name: 'VideoPlayer',
      // 组件的其他代码逻辑
    }
    </script>
    

    在这个示例中,你可以将path_to_video_file替换为你的视频文件的路径或URL。在浏览器中加载Vue应用时,这个视频将被嵌入到页面中并显示出来。

    如果你想实现更高级的视频编辑功能,例如剪辑、添加特效等,你可能需要使用其他库或工具来处理视频相关的操作。一些流行的视频编辑库包括:

    • Video.js:一个开源的HTML5视频播放器,提供了多种功能和插件,可以定制和扩展。
    • FFmpeg:一个强大的跨平台的多媒体框架,可以用于视频的剪辑、合并、转码等操作。
    • Adobe Premiere Pro:一个专业级的视频编辑软件,提供了丰富的功能和工具。

    你可以在Vue应用中使用这些库来实现视频编辑功能,具体的实现方法将取决于你的需求和所使用的工具。根据你的具体情况,你可能需要阅读相关文档和示例代码,以便更好地理解和应用这些库和工具。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ue.js是一个用于构建用户界面的JavaScript框架,它主要用于创建交互式的单页面应用程序。Vue本身并不是用来编辑视频的工具,而是用来创建和管理用户界面的。因此,Vue不能直接用来编辑视频。

    编辑视频需要使用专门的视频编辑工具或库,例如Adobe Premiere Pro、Final Cut Pro等。这些工具提供了丰富的视频编辑功能,可以对视频进行剪辑、修剪、添加特效、添加字幕等操作。

    但是,Vue可以与视频编辑工具一起使用,用来实现用户界面与视频编辑功能的交互。例如,在Vue应用程序中可以使用组件来显示视频编辑窗口、视频剪辑器等界面,通过与视频编辑工具的API进行通信,实现对视频素材的编辑操作。

    总结起来,Vue本身不能直接用来编辑视频,但可以与视频编辑工具结合使用,来创建具有视频编辑功能的应用程序。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    为了能够回答你的问题,首先我们需要理解一下你所说的“vue编辑不了视频”具体是指什么意思。如果你是指在Vue.js框架下无法使用编辑视频的功能,那么需要说明一下你具体想要实现的功能是什么,以及你使用的是哪种编辑器或插件。

    在Vue.js框架下,编辑视频的功能不是Vue.js本身的内置功能,但可以通过使用第三方库或编辑器来实现。下面提供两种常见的实现方式。

    一、使用第三方库:

    1. 集成video.js:video.js是一个开源的HTML5视频播放器框架,它提供了一系列的API和插件,可以用于视频的编辑和播放。你可以使用npm包管理工具安装video.js,然后在Vue组件中引用video.js并使用它的API来实现视频编辑功能。

    安装video.js:

    npm install video.js
    

    在Vue组件中引用video.js:

    import videojs from 'video.js'
    
    export default {
      mounted() {
        // 初始化video.js
        this.player = videojs(this.$refs.myVideo, /* options */);
      },
      beforeDestroy() {
        // 销毁video.js实例
        if (this.player) {
          this.player.dispose();
        }
      },
      methods: {
        // 实现视频编辑功能的方法
        // ...
      }
    }
    
    1. 使用其他第三方视频编辑库:除了video.js,还有其他一些适用于视频编辑的第三方库,如Quill.js,CKEditor等。你可以根据具体的功能需求选择合适的第三方库,然后在Vue组件中集成使用。

    二、使用视频编辑器插件:
    如果你想要在Vue.js框架下使用视频编辑器插件,那么一般需要找到一个Vue插件库,该库提供了与视频编辑器相关的组件,你可以在Vue组件中使用这些组件来实现视频编辑的功能。

    你可以通过在npm包管理工具中搜索相关的插件,如“vue video editor”,找到适合的插件库,然后按照插件提供的文档进行安装和使用。

    无论你是选择使用第三方库还是视频编辑器插件,都需要明确你想要实现的具体功能,并根据文档或示例代码中提供的方法和操作流程来进行开发。

    总结起来,要在Vue.js框架下实现视频编辑的功能,你可以使用第三方库或视频编辑器插件来帮助你完成需求。通过具体的案例和方法操作流程,你可以实现你想要的视频编辑功能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部